Title: Order of the Roberge-Weiss endpoint (finite size transition) in QCD

We consider the endpoint of the Roberge-Weiss (RW) first order transition line present for imaginary baryon chemical potentials. We remark that it coincides with the finite size transition relevant in the context of large N{sub c} QCD and study its order in the theory with two degenerate flavors. The RW endpoint is first order in the limit of large and small quark masses, while it weakens for intermediate masses where it is likely in the Ising 3D universality class. Phenomenological implications and further speculations about the QCD phase diagram are discuss0008.
